Double acting cylinders provide power in both extension and retraction. They are the most common choice on modern tractors for precise control of loader arms, rear implements and auxiliary functions.
Single acting cylinders use hydraulic pressure to lift and gravity to return. They are ideal for dump trailers, small loaders and other applications where the load can fall back by itself.
Tie rod cylinders are built with external tie rods that clamp the tube and end caps. They are easy to service and well suited for tractors working in workshops, small farms and light industrial jobs.
Welded cylinders have a compact body and strong welded construction. They are widely used on modern tractors where space is tight and long service life under vibration is required.
Telescopic cylinders provide a very long stroke with a short retracted length. They are perfect for lifting high dump bodies or grain boxes using the tractor’s hydraulic power.

See where different tractor hydraulic cylinders work on the machine – from the front loader arms to the three-point hitch and towing system.
Position on tractor: mounted on the front loader arms between the loader boom and the tractor frame.
These cylinders raise and lower the front loader, helping the tractor handle buckets, pallets and bale clamps in farm work.
Position on tractor: fixed to the front axle or steering linkage, connected to the steering knuckles.
Steering cylinders convert steering wheel input into smooth movement of the front wheels, keeping the tractor controllable in fields and on roads.
Position on tractor: installed as the upper link of the rear three-point hitch between tractor and implement.
Hydraulic top links adjust the tilt angle of rear implements such as ploughs, blades and seeders directly from the cab.
Position on tractor: mounted on one or both lower arms of the three-point hitch.
These cylinders level the rear hitch from side to side, keeping implements such as graders and mowers working flat on uneven ground.
Position on tractor: connected to the rear lift arms inside or outside the rear housing.
Three-point hitch cylinders raise and lower the rear arms, lifting ploughs, planters, rotary tillers and other mounted implements.
Position on tractor: used on towed equipment drawbars, trailer beds or hitch frames behind the tractor.
These cylinders operate tipping trailers, dump wagons and other towed implements, making loading and unloading much faster and safer.

From raw material preparation to final testing, every cylinder follows a strict production flow to ensure quality and reliability.
Cylinder tubes and piston rods are cut to precise lengths using automated cutting equipment to ensure dimensional accuracy.
Precision machining of cylinder tubes, rods, end caps and ports ensures perfect fitment and smooth hydraulic performance.
Automated or manual welding secures cylinder bases and mounts, ensuring strong structural integrity under heavy tractor loads.
The inner tube is honed to achieve perfect smoothness, improving seal life and reducing friction for long-term durability.
Piston, rod, seals and end caps are assembled with strict tolerance control to ensure smooth and reliable hydraulic performance.
Each cylinder undergoes high-pressure testing to ensure no leakage, correct movement, and stable performance before shipment.

Most tractor cylinders operate between 16–25 MPa (2300–3600 PSI), depending on the model. We can build cylinders for higher pressure if your application requires it.
Measure the bore size, rod diameter, stroke length, mounting style, port size, and working pressure. If unsure, send photos, and our team will confirm the correct model for your tractor.
